超融合与边缘计算:技术融合与场景落地的终极解析
2025.10.10 16:15浏览量:1简介:本文深入解析超融合架构与边缘计算的核心技术、协同机制及落地场景,从架构对比、性能优化到典型行业应用,为开发者与企业用户提供可落地的技术指南。
一、超融合与边缘计算的技术本质解析
1.1 超融合:从虚拟化到云原生的架构革命
超融合基础设施(HCI)通过软件定义技术将计算、存储、网络和虚拟化资源整合为统一资源池,其核心在于去中心化架构与横向扩展能力。传统三层架构(计算+存储+网络)存在资源割裂、管理复杂的问题,而超融合通过分布式存储(如Ceph、vSAN)和虚拟化平台(如VMware ESXi、KVM)的深度集成,实现了资源的高效利用。
技术关键点:
- 分布式存储层:采用多副本、纠删码技术保障数据可靠性,例如Ceph的CRUSH算法可动态分配数据块。
- 软件定义网络(SDN):通过VxLAN或NVGRE实现跨节点二层互通,解决虚拟机迁移时的网络配置问题。
- 统一管理平台:如Nutanix Prism、VMware vCenter,提供资源监控、自动扩容和故障自愈能力。
代码示例(Python模拟资源调度):
class ResourcePool:def __init__(self):self.nodes = [{"cpu": 16, "memory": 64, "storage": 512}] * 3 # 3节点集群def allocate(self, req_cpu, req_mem):for node in self.nodes:if node["cpu"] >= req_cpu and node["memory"] >= req_mem:node["cpu"] -= req_cpunode["memory"] -= req_memreturn Truereturn False# 模拟资源分配pool = ResourcePool()print(pool.allocate(8, 32)) # 输出True,表示分配成功
1.2 边缘计算:从中心到边缘的算力重构
边缘计算将数据处理能力下沉至靠近数据源的边缘节点(如基站、工业网关),其核心价值在于低延迟(<10ms)和数据本地化。与云计算的“中心化”模式不同,边缘计算通过分布式架构解决实时性要求高的场景(如自动驾驶、工业控制)。
技术关键点:
- 轻量化容器:使用K3s、MicroK8s等轻量级Kubernetes发行版,减少资源占用。
- 边缘协议优化:MQTT协议(QoS 0/1/2)适配不同网络环境,例如工业场景中QoS 1保障指令可靠传输。
- 边缘-云协同:通过AWS Greengrass、Azure IoT Edge实现边缘节点与云端的模型同步和任务分发。
代码示例(MQTT客户端):
import paho.mqtt.client as mqttdef on_connect(client, userdata, flags, rc):print("Connected with result code " + str(rc))client.subscribe("sensor/temperature")def on_message(client, userdata, msg):print(f"Received: {msg.payload.decode()} from {msg.topic}")client = mqtt.Client()client.on_connect = on_connectclient.on_message = on_messageclient.connect("edge-node", 1883, 60)client.loop_forever()
二、超融合与边缘计算的协同机制
2.1 架构融合:超融合为边缘提供弹性底座
超融合的分布式架构天然适合边缘场景,例如:
- 资源池化:边缘节点通过超融合架构共享存储和计算资源,避免单点故障。
- 动态扩容:当边缘设备数量增加时,可通过添加节点实现线性扩展(如Nutanix的“一键扩容”功能)。
- 数据分层:热数据存储在边缘节点,冷数据归档至云端,降低带宽成本。
典型案例:某智能制造企业通过超融合架构整合工厂内的PLC、摄像头和AGV数据,边缘节点处理实时控制指令,超融合集群存储历史数据并运行分析模型。
2.2 性能优化:边缘场景下的超融合调优
- 存储优化:在边缘节点部署SSD缓存层,加速热数据访问(如vSAN的缓存层级策略)。
- 网络压缩:使用SR-IOV技术减少虚拟化网络开销,降低延迟(实测可提升30%吞吐量)。
- 容器化部署:将超融合管理组件(如Cinder、Neutron)容器化,提升边缘节点部署效率。
性能对比表:
| 指标 | 传统架构 | 超融合+边缘架构 | 提升幅度 |
|———————|—————|—————————|—————|
| 虚拟机启动时间 | 2分钟 | 15秒 | 8倍 |
| 存储IOPS | 5K | 50K | 10倍 |
| 网络延迟 | 50ms | 5ms | 90%降低 |
三、行业落地场景与实施建议
3.1 工业互联网:实时控制与预测维护
- 场景:钢铁厂高炉温度监控,需毫秒级响应。
- 方案:边缘节点部署超融合轻量版(如StarlingX),运行温度预测模型(LSTM算法),超融合集群存储历史数据。
- 收益:故障预测准确率提升40%,停机时间减少60%。
3.2 智慧城市:交通信号优化
- 场景:十字路口车流量动态调整信号灯。
- 方案:边缘网关(如Raspberry Pi 4B)运行YOLOv5目标检测模型,超融合集群汇总数据并优化配时算法。
- 代码片段(信号灯控制逻辑):
def adjust_traffic_light(vehicle_count):if vehicle_count > 50:return "GREEN_EXTENDED" # 延长绿灯时间else:return "NORMAL_CYCLE"
3.3 实施建议
- 分阶段落地:先在单一场景(如工厂产线)试点,再逐步扩展至全厂。
- 硬件选型:边缘节点推荐使用NVIDIA Jetson AGX Orin(算力275TOPS),超融合集群采用戴尔EMC VxRail。
- 安全加固:启用TLS 1.3加密边缘-云通信,使用Intel SGX技术保护敏感数据。
四、未来趋势:超融合与边缘计算的深度融合
- AI原生架构:超融合平台内置AI推理引擎(如TensorRT),边缘节点直接运行轻量级模型。
- 5G MEC集成:通过UPF网元将超融合资源池化至运营商边缘节点,实现“网络即服务”。
- 零信任安全:基于SPIFFE标准的身份认证,确保边缘-超融合-云的全链路安全。
结语:超融合与边缘计算的融合并非简单叠加,而是通过架构创新实现资源、算力和数据的全局优化。对于开发者而言,掌握两者协同机制可开发出更高性能的边缘应用;对于企业用户,选择具备超融合能力的边缘解决方案能显著降低TCO(总拥有成本)。未来,随着AI和5G的普及,这一技术组合将成为数字化转型的核心基础设施。

发表评论
登录后可评论,请前往 登录 或 注册